Portraits: the Artist in Print
Portraits: the Artist in Print
Erin Barnett, curator
Rachel Epp Buller, curator
April 3, 1999–May 23, 1999
Spencer Museum of Art, University of Kansas, Lawrence, Kansas

This exhibition of prints and photographs investigates the traditions of self-portraiture and portraits of artists. It includes examples of traditional, formal portraiture as well as portraits in more informal settings. There are portraits of the artist at work, portraits of artists anachronis-tically included in historical depictions, as well as symbolic and allegorical self-portraits.
